  6. Many autistic adults shudder when recalling school memories.

    But why do autistic people suffer so much at school?

    Historically, it’s been framed that a) school is above reproach, and b) there’s always something wrong with the child who doesn’t manage, and not the environment.

    Some are starting to question that.

  18. How oppression comes about through people's micro-interactions. 🤷‍♀️

    Seven patterns of dominance:

    👑 1. Tolerance.

    Allowing small doses of difference (especially those that are of benefit to my own or my company/organization's agenda).

    But never enough to cause change to the power relationship.
    Diversity, but not equity!

  20. So no. Autistic people are not ‘just making it up because society is crap’.

    The reality is more like this:

    Society is often crap, and autistic people are then forced to explain their real differences through a diagnostic system built around pathology, gatekeeping, and disbelief.

  22. Subject: Information processing in autism. Is our style necessarily a deficit?

    Why do autistic people find new or high-stimulus environments stressful; even overwhelming?

    Why can it seem, at times, we're slower than others? To take in scenes; to mentally process them; to make decisions based on them 🤷

    This thread is an alternative take on autistic processing style & speed.
